CAMBRIDGE, Mass-- There is a story about how the modern golf ball, with its dimpled surface, came to be: In the mid-1800s, it is said, new golf balls were smooth, but became dimpled over time as impacts left permanent dents. Smooth new balls were typically used for tournament play, but in one match, a player ran short, had to use an old, dented one, and realized that he could drive this dimpled ball much further than a smooth one.

LAS CRUCES, NM – High-profile marketing campaigns for nuts such as pistachios and almonds have become familiar to consumers throughout the United States. Shining a spotlight on these products has increased public awareness and boosted sales. For example, domestic per-capita almond consumption has increased five-fold since 1976, thanks in part to savvy marketing efforts. In contrast, the pecan industry been successful in focusing their efforts on expanding pecan export markets, but pecan consumption in the U.S. has remained relatively flat over the past 35 years.

QUEBEC – In Canada, where outdoor growing seasons are limited, sales from greenhouse fruit and vegetable production operations still surpass $1.1 billion annually. Finding more efficient methods for providing lighting in greenhouse production is a key component to support these high levels of production and increase revenues. "Light irradiance is the limiting factor for increasing production in greenhouses, when all other factors (temperature, nutrient levels, and water availability) are adequately maintained," said the authors of a new study.

CAMBRIDGE, MA -- The more cores — or processing units — a computer chip has, the bigger the problem of communication between cores becomes. For years, Li-Shiuan Peh, the Singapore Research Professor of Electrical Engineering and Computer Science at MIT, has argued that the massively multicore chips of the future will need to resemble little Internets, where each core has an associated router, and data travels between cores in packets of fixed size.

Press the start button, switch on the monitor, grab a cup of coffee and off you go. That is pretty much how most us experience booting up a computer. But with a quantum computer the situation is very different. So far, researchers have had to spend hours making dozens of adjustments and fine calibrations in order to set up a chip with just five quantum bits so that it can be used for experimental work. (One quantum bit or 'qubit' is the quantum physical equivalent of a single bit in a conventional computer).

CHICAGO, IL—Almost 70 percent of adults with Type 1 diabetes never use their blood glucose self-monitoring devices or insulin pumps to download historical data about their blood sugar levels and insulin doses—information that likely would help them manage their disease better. These new survey results, which were presented Sunday at the joint meeting of the International Society of Endocrinology and the Endocrine Society: ICE/ENDO 2014 in Chicago, also show that only 12 percent of patients regularly review their past glucose and insulin pump data at home.

In the past years, invisibility cloaks were developed for various senses. Objects can be hidden from light, heat or sound. However, hiding of an object from being touched still remained to be accomplished. KIT scientists have now succeeded in creating a volume in which an object can be hidden from touching similar to a pea under the mattress of a princess. The results are now presented in the renowned Nature Communications journal.

CAMBRIDGE, Mass-- What's the difference between the Eiffel Tower and the Washington Monument?

Both structures soar to impressive heights, and each was the world's tallest building when completed. But the Washington Monument is a massive stone structure, while the Eiffel Tower achieves similar strength using a lattice of steel beams and struts that is mostly open air, gaining its strength from the geometric arrangement of those elements.
